Using Copilot to update a guidance document
1. Get meeting insights
Review meeting details to determine the changes to be made in the RFx document.
Copilot in Teams
In Meeting Recap, review meeting #Topics to quickly locate the relevant details for your document updates.
2. Ask questions
Use Copilot to locate the latest RFx document that needs updating based on the stakeholder request.
Copilot2
Locate the latest RFx document created by your team in the last week.
3. Analyze financial impact
Adjust your financial model to confirm the expected change in costs and review where it exceeds your thresh hold.
Copilot in Excel
Highlight the cells yellow where the “adjusted expected spend” exceeds $10,000.
4. Efficient document updates
Rewrite the relevant document sections that need updating based on the new RFx information.
Copilot in Word
Summarize the updated sections into a few bullet points. This will be added with your Microsoft Excel chart in an email to the stakeholder.
5. Request feedback
Draft and send an email to your stakeholder summarizing the changes.
Copilot in Outlook
Use Coaching by Copilot: write an email to my stakeholder outlining the updates, gain alignment, and offer a meeting to discuss.
